What is an Oak Cot Bed?
An oak cot bed is a sleeping arrangement for infants that is built primarily from oak wood. Known for its strength and longevity, oak is a hardwood that can hold up against everyday wear and tear and uses a visually striking finish. Oak cot beds can frequently be converted into toddler beds, making them a financial investment that lasts beyond the baby years.

To ensure that your oak cot bed stays in great condition for several years to come, regular upkeep is necessary. Here are some practical ideas:
Dust Regularly: Use a soft, lint-free fabric to dust the cot bed to prevent dirt build-up and preserve its shine.
Avoid Harsh Chemicals: When cleaning your oak cot bed, prevent using ammonia-based cleaners or any extreme chemicals that could damage the wood.
Use a Mild Soap: If necessary, clean with a solution of mild soap and warm water, rubbing out any residue with a slightly moist cloth.
Polish Occasionally: Use a wood-friendly polish or wax every couple of months to enhance the finish and offer a layer of defense.
Look for Stability: Periodically check the cot bed for any loose screws or structural weaknesses, tightening up or fixing as needed.
Frequently Asked Question About Oak Cot Beds
Are oak cot beds safe for newborns?Yes, as long as they meet current safety regulations and requirements. Always guarantee that the cot bed abides by guidelines set by relevant authorities.
The length of time can my child utilize an oak cot bed?The majority of oak cot beds can be used from birth until roughly 4 years of ages when they can be transformed into a toddler bed.
What size bed mattress fits an oak cot bed?Generally, cot beds fit a mattress size of 140 x 70 cm (55 x 27 inches). Always check maker requirements before acquiring.
Can I select an oak cot bed with adjustable mattress heights?Yes, lots of oak cot beds include adjustable heights, allowing moms and dads to reduce the bed mattress as their baby grows, making sure security as the child ends up being more mobile.
Do oak cot beds need assembly?Yes, most oak cot beds require some assembly but normally included clear guidelines and the required tools.
